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Urbana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Urbana with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Urbana is at 205 Stoughton listed at $455.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Urbana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Urbana is $1,266.

What is the largest available Studio Urbana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Urbana is a 1,030 square feet unit starting from $455 at 205 Stoughton.

What is the average size for Urbana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Urbana is currently 433 sq ft.

Battling the Butts: Your Guide to the Reality of Smoke-Free Renting

Written by: Andrea Lee Negroni, JD

While many apartment buildings are “no smoking” properties, it’s hard to know exactly how many. In 2017, the National Apartment Association reported more than half of rental properties had smoke free policies.
